Visible light-induced synthesis of polysubstituted oxazoles from diazo compounds

Org Biomol Chem. 2023 Jul 12;21(27):5511-5515. doi: 10.1039/d3ob00878a.

Abstract

Herein, a visible light-induced synthesis of polysubstituted oxazoles from diazo compounds is reported. This developed synthetic method differs from traditional routes that rely on transition metals and external chemical oxidants. Our method uses readily available and inexpensive diazonium compounds as well as nitrile substrates with a catalytic amount of (i-Pr)3SiCl species, delivering the corresponding valuable multi-substituted oxazole products (up to 95% yield). This protocol exhibits a broad substrate scope and is easily carried out under mild reaction conditions. Notably, gram-scale synthesis in a continuous flow fashion has been performed.
